当前位置:首页 > 范文大全 > 正文内容

Crafting a Compelling English Job Application for a Computer Science Role: A Comprehensive Guide

范文网2025-04-05 03:29范文大全931

Introduction

In the realm of technology, where innovation and progress are constant, securing a job in the computer science field can be both challenging and rewarding. A well-crafted job application, particularly an English one if your target audience is primarily non-native speakers, can give you the edge needed to stand out among a sea of talented applicants. This guide aims to provide you with the tools and strategies to create a compelling computer science job application that resonates with hiring managers and showcases your unique skills and passion for the field.

Crafting a Compelling English Job Application for a Computer Science Role: A Comprehensive Guide

Understanding Your Audience

Before diving into the specifics of writing your application, it's crucial to understand your audience—the hiring manager or recruitment team. They are likely to be busy professionals who receive numerous applications daily, making it essential to capture their attention early on. Keep your language concise, professional, and tailored to their needs. Remember, clarity and precision are key in technical fields like computer science.

Structuring Your Application

A typical job application for a computer science position can be divided into several key sections:

1、Cover Letter

2、Resume

3、Portfolio/GitHub Profile (if applicable)

4、Optional: Follow-up Email or Phone Call

Each section serves a purpose and should be crafted with care to showcase your skills and experience effectively.

1. Cover Letter: The First Impression

Your cover letter is your opportunity to introduce yourself and briefly explain why you're the ideal candidate for the role. It should be tailored to the specific job listing and highlight your relevant skills, achievements, and how they align with the job requirements. Here are some tips for writing an effective cover letter:

Start with a Strong Opening: Use a professional greeting and a brief introduction that grabs the reader's attention.

Highlight Relevant Experience: Focus on your most relevant experience and achievements related to the job. Use quantifiable data where possible (e.g., "Developed a software solution that increased efficiency by 30%").

Demonstrate Passion: Share your passion for computer science and how it has shaped your career aspirations.

End with a Call to Action: Conclude by expressing your enthusiasm for the position and thanking them for considering your application.

Proofread & Edit: Ensure your letter is error-free and free from grammatical mistakes. Consider getting a second opinion before submitting.

2. Resume: The Snapshot of Your Career

Your resume is a summary of your professional experience and education. It should be concise, easy to read, and highlight your technical skills, projects, and accomplishments. Here are some best practices for crafting a computer science resume:

Use a Clear Format: Opt for a reverse chronological or functional format depending on your experience level.

Highlight Key Skills: List your top technical skills (e.g., programming languages, frameworks, tools) prominently.

Quantify Your Achievements: Use numbers to quantify your impact wherever possible (e.g., "Managed a team of 15 developers, resulting in a 40% increase in productivity").

Include Projects: Describe key projects you've worked on, focusing on what you did, the tools used, and the outcomes achieved.

Keep it Brief: Limit your resume to 1-2 pages for entry-level to mid-level positions; more experienced candidates may need up to 3 pages.

Proofread & Format Correctly: Ensure your resume is free from errors and formatted for easy scanning. Use bolding, bullet points, and consistent font sizes.

3. Portfolio/GitHub Profile: Showcasing Your Work

For many computer science roles, especially those involving software development, having an online portfolio or a well-maintained GitHub profile can be just as important as your resume and cover letter. This is where you can demonstrate your coding skills, showcase your projects, and provide examples of your work. Here are some tips for creating an impressive portfolio:

Include Diverse Projects: Display a range of projects that demonstrate your versatility, from simple scripts to complex systems.

Explain Your Work: Provide clear explanations of what each project does, the technologies used, and any challenges you faced during development.

Use Good Practices: Ensure your code is clean, well-commented, and follows best practices (e.g., using version control).

Update Regularly: Keep your portfolio up-to-date with new projects and achievements.

Include Feedback: If possible, include feedback from mentors, teachers, or previous employers to add credibility.

4. Optional: Follow-up Email or Phone Call

After submitting your application, consider following up with an email or phone call a few days later to express your continued interest in the position. This can be particularly effective if you have any additional questions or want to provide additional information that wasn't included in your initial application. Be polite, professional, and respectful of their time during this follow-up communication.

Final Thoughts

Crafting an outstanding English job application for a computer science role requires attention to detail, a clear understanding of the position's requirements, and an ability to showcase your skills and achievements effectively. By following the tips outlined above—tailoring your cover letter, crafting a concise yet impactful resume, showcasing your work through a portfolio or GitHub profile, and considering a follow-up communication—you can increase your chances of landing that dream job in the competitive tech industry. Remember, every word counts; invest time in refining your application until it truly reflects who you are as a professional and the value you can bring to the team. Good luck!

“Crafting a Compelling English Job Application for a Computer Science Role: A Comprehensive Guide” 的相关文章

一年级小学生素质发现报告册家长意见撰写指南

一年级小学生素质发现报告册家长意见撰写指南

随着教育的不断进步,对孩子们全面发展的关注也日益增强,一年级小学生素质发现报告册是反映孩子在这一年度成长与发展的重要载体,家长意见则是其中不可或缺的部分,如何撰写家长意见,既能全面反映孩子的成长,又能表达对学校和老师的感激,成为许多家长关注的问题,本文旨在提供一年级小学生素质发现报告册家长意见的撰写...

七年级下册语文教案——如何写好写事作文

七年级下册语文教案——如何写好写事作文

教学目标1、让学生了解写事作文的基本特点和要求。2、学会选取真实、生动、具有代表性的事件。3、掌握写事作文的基本结构,能够清晰、有条理地叙述事件。4、培养学生的观察力和表达能力,提高写作兴趣。写事作文的基本特点写事作文是以事件为中心,通过具体的事件来展示人物、表达主题,写事作文要求真实、生动、具有代...

2010年央视春晚开幕词,绽放的盛世之花

2010年央视春晚开幕词,绽放的盛世之花

随着岁月的脚步,我们迎来了崭新的年份,也迎来了备受瞩目的盛事——2010年央视春晚,这场盛大的文艺盛宴,以其独特的魅力,吸引了亿万观众的眼球,而开幕词,作为整场晚会的序曲,更是为这场盛宴定下了基调,本文将带您回顾2010年央视春晚的开幕词,感受那绽放的盛世之花。夜幕降临,灯光璀璨,央视春晚的舞台宛如...

三国演义中的小故事,草船借箭与借东风的智慧

三国演义中的小故事,草船借箭与借东风的智慧

《三国演义》作为中国古代四大名著之一,以其波澜壮阔的历史背景、丰富的人物形象以及曲折动人的故事情节,吸引了无数读者,在众多故事中,草船借箭与借东风两个小故事,以其独特的智慧与策略,成为了《三国演义》中的经典篇章。草船借箭1、故事背景草船借箭发生在赤壁之战前夕,周瑜为破曹操的连环船,决定利用智谋与诸葛...

法人授权委托书怎么写

法人授权委托书怎么写

在现代社会,法人授权委托书在企业和组织运营中扮演着重要角色,一份有效的法人授权委托书能够明确委托人和受托人之间的权责关系,确保事务的顺利进行,本文将详细介绍如何撰写一份合法、合规的法人授权委托书。(一)明确委托人和受托人信息1、委托人信息:包括姓名(或企业名称)、身份证号(或统一社会信用代码)、联系...

父亲节的一句双重祝福,愿您的节日充满温馨与喜悦

父亲节的一句双重祝福,愿您的节日充满温馨与喜悦

随着六月的到来,父亲节也即将来临,在这个充满感恩与敬意的日子里,我们总是想要向自己的父亲表达深深的感激和祝福,在这个特殊的时刻,除了向自己的父亲献上祝福,我们是否也能将这份温暖传递给那些在我们生活中扮演着重要角色的人——比如女朋友的爸爸,如何在父亲节这一天,既表达对自己父亲的感激,又向女朋友的爸爸送...